As a Technical Director of Controls Engineering in the R&D group, you will provide leadership for developing control systems for electrical, thermal, and mechanical systems used in distributed energy resources and power distribution. Collaborating with subject matter experts, research engineers, product strategy teams, and systems engineers, your team will create accurate and efficient control systems, optimization, and analytics algorithms to support technologies and products development within the Product Engineering organization. Through your expertise, you will play a key role in driving innovation and performance improvements in distributed energy and power distribution systems.

M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S

Education: Master's degree in engineering, Computer Science, or related field. Ph.D. in Engineering, Computer Science, or related field preferred.

Experience: 15+ years of experience in controls systems design, optimization algorithms, AI, and predictive analytics

  • Proficiency in time-domain simulation software such as MATLAB, Simulink, or similar tools for controls systems design, pure simulation, or real time operating platforms
  • Experience with Python, C++, or similar environments for development of optimization tools and controls logic
  • Knowledge of multi-physics modeling software such as Simscape, Simcenter Amesim, GT Suite, or similar
  • Experience with HIL platforms including dSpace, speedgoat, NI, or others for testing of controls systems
  • Experience or familiarity with control system design, PLCs, or SCADA systems for microgrids
  • Experience with implementation of automated continuous integration and deployment processes for software deployment
  • Strong understanding of renewable energy systems including solar, wind, power conversion, and battery energy storage systems.
  • Knowledge of power distribution concepts including uninterrupted power supply and power converters
  • Experience with management systems for battery energy storage, control of thermal management systems, optimization algorithms for energy management systems
  • Experience using version control for software, modeling and simulation including Git or other similar tools
  • Must have familiarity with R&D processes, R&D documentation, and technical acumen to present to both technical and non-technical audiences

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Lead control system design, implementation, and validation for innovative technology and product development for AI, Machine Learning, and predictive algorithms
  • Lead a team to develop proof-of-concept distributed software algorithms to support emerging AI and optimization systems and provide functional recommendations to software and hardware design teams
  • Collaborate with component and domain subject matter experts to translate functional requirements into system controls, optimization, and diagnostics algorithms
  • Lead development and implementation of AI, Machine Learning, and optimization algorithms following a model-based development approach for a variety of electrical, thermal, and mechanical systems and eco-systems for distributed energy resources, energy management, and power distribution
  • Lead processes for design of complex controls systems in a physics-based modeling and simulation environment ahead of hardware implementation, edge, or cloud implementation
  • Utilize DOE, optimization methods, and data driven modeling and analysis tools
  • Lead the definition of AI, optimization, and predictive algorithm software roadmaps and capability for R&D and Product Engineering
